How to Make Crispy Cottage Cheese Chips

Preheat Oven and Prepare Baking Surface

To start, pre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). It’s crucial to get the heat just right for achieving that fantastic crunch. Line a large baking sheet with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at. This will help prevent sticking and ensure even cooking. Efficient prep translates to crispy results!

Drain Cottage Cheese

Next, it’s time to drain the cottage cheese. Place it in a fine-mesh sieve and gently press to release any excess liquid. Then, pat it dry with paper towels. This step cannot be skipped! Removing moisture is key to getting those chips perfectly crispy when baked.

Combine Ingredients

Now, grab a mixing bowl and combine your drained cottage cheese with garlic powder, onion powder, smoked paprika, black pepper, and salt. Stir carefully until everything is evenly blended. This simple blending creates a flavorful base for your chips, so take a minute to get it right!

Shape Chips

It’s shaping time! Spoon tablespoon-sized portions of the mixture onto your prepared baking sheet, spacing them about 2 inches apart. Next, gently flatten each mound with the back of a spoon into circles about 2 to 2.5 inches wide. This will ensure they cook evenly and achieve that desirable chip-like texture.

Add Optional Toppings

If you want to elevate your chips even further, sprinkle some chopped chives or grated Parmesan cheese on top of each chip. These toppings can take the flavor to another level, transforming your snack into something truly special!

Bake Until Crisp

Place your baking sheet in the oven and bake your delicious Crispy Cottage Cheese Chips for 30 to 35 minutes. Keep an eye on them! They’re done when the edges turn golden brown and they feel nice and crispy. This is where the magic happens, so patience is essential!

Cool Chips

Once baked, let the chips cool completely on the baking sheet. Cooling is vital; it enhances the crispiness and prevents them from becoming soggy. Just a little bit of time will reward you with that satisfying crunch!

Serve or Store

Lastly, carefully remove your chips from the parchment and serve them immediately for the best experience. If you have leftovers, store them in an airtight container for up to two days. However, I doubt they’ll last that long because they’re just so irresistible!

Tips for Success

  • Ensure your cottage cheese is well-drained to achieve maximum crispiness.
  • Experiment with different seasonings to find your favorite flavor combinations.
  • Don’t overcrowd the baking sheet; give each chip room to breathe.
  • Try baking in batches if your oven is smaller to ensure even cooking.
  • Keep an eye on the chips during the final minutes; they can go from perfect to overdone quickly!

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ups (16 oz) cottage cheese, full-fat or low-fat, small curd preferred
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on smoked paprika (optional)
  • 1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1 tablespoon finely chopped chives (optional)
  • 1 tablespoon grated Parmesan cheese (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ven and prepare baking surface: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a large baking sheet with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at.
  2. Drain cottage cheese: Place cottage cheese in a fine-mesh sieve and press gently to remove excess liquid. Pat dry with paper towels to enhance crispiness.
  3. Combine ingredients: In a mixing bowl, blend drained cottage cheese with garlic powder, onion powder, smoked paprika, black pepper, and salt until uniform.
  4. Shape chips: Spoon tablespoon-sized portions onto the baking sheet, spacing 2 inches apart. Gently flatten each mound with the back of a spoon into circles approximately 2 to 2.5 inches in diameter.
  5. Add optional toppings: Sprinkle chopped chives or grated Parmesan cheese over each chip if desired.
  6. Bake until crisp: Bake for 30 to 35 minutes until edges are golden brown and chips are crispy.
  7. Cool chips: Allow chips to cool completely on the baking sheet to achieve maximum crispiness.
  8. Serve or store: Carefully remove chips from the parchment and serve immediately, or store in an airtight container for up to 2 days.
